Turn one idea into a thread people actually finish
Expands a single idea into a multi-post social thread with a promise-keeping hook and one point per post.
When to use it: When you have one genuinely good insight and want a thread that holds attention instead of padding it into filler.
You are a social media editor turning one idea into a thread. A thread earns its length; if the idea supports four posts, four is the answer.
Inputs:
- PLATFORM: [e.g. "X" / "LinkedIn" - note character limits that apply]
- THE ONE IDEA: [state it in a sentence or two]
- MY EVIDENCE: [the story, numbers, steps or examples behind it - from my own experience]
- AUDIENCE + WHAT I WANT FROM THEM: [e.g. "small retailers; follows and replies"]
- VOICE: [e.g. "direct, a bit dry, no emoji"]
Before writing, split the idea into its distinct points - one per post - and cut any point that repeats another in different clothes. State the final post count and why.
Requirements:
1. The hook post makes a specific, checkable promise about what the reader gets - no "a thread on...", no engagement-bait cliffhangers.
2. One point per post; each post must stand alone if screenshotted.
3. Use my concrete numbers, story beats and examples - the specificity carries the thread.
4. Midway, add a re-hook: a line that re-earns attention (a turn, a surprising number, an admission).
5. The closer restates the promise kept in one line, then ONE call to action matching my stated goal.
6. Respect platform limits per post; vary sentence rhythm; write in my stated voice.
Output: numbered posts with character counts, then 2 alternative hook posts, then a one-line note on the best time-agnostic reason this thread would be shared.
Grounding: only my provided evidence appears - no borrowed statistics, no invented anecdotes; gaps become [NEEDED: ...].
